ABGI Technology is recruiting for its client, an innovative French company in the mobile technology sector that designs and develops devices and accessories engineered to offer high robustness and optimal reliability in demanding environments. Its solutions are aimed at both field professionals and users who need durable equipment suitable for intensive use. Guided by a strong culture of innovation and customer focus, it emphasises quality, resistance and longevity to meet the operational constraints of everyday use. To support its growth, it is looking for its future Product Laboratory Project Manager Saudi Arabian F/M on a permanent contract, based in Aix‑En‑Provence or Saudi Arabian. 🔎 Your Responsibilities The Laboratory Project Manager oversees the transfer, setup, and operational launch of a mobile phone testing laboratory in Saudi Arabia. He/She coordinates the transfer of equipment, methods, and expertise from existing laboratories in France and China, ensuring technical continuity, quality compliance, and operational excellence. This position plays a key role in establishing a reference laboratory for product certification, validation, and performance testing. Main Responsibilities Laboratory Transfer Management: Plan and supervise the transfer of testing equipment from current sites (France and China). Ensure that local installations meet all technical and safety standards (electrical, EMC, environmental, calibration). Oversee dismantling, shipping, reinstallation, and recalibration of testing benches and measuring instruments. Guarantee full traceability and technical documentation for all transferred equipment. Laboratory Setup and Qualification: Define physical layout, workflows, infrastructure, and safety requirements. Manage relationships with local contractors (construction, logistics, calibration, certification). Ensure initial qualification of the laboratory (IQ/OQ/PQ) in line with Group standards. Define preventive maintenance and metrology plans. Test Procedures and Reporting: Define and document standard operating procedures (SOPs) for all test activities. Develop detailed test plans and ensure alignment with Group methodologies. Supervise the execution and documentation of validation, reliability, and certification tests. Consolidate and analyze test data to identify trends, deviations, and improvement opportunities. Prepare clear, structured test reports for internal stakeholders, management, and certification partners. International Coordination: Serve as the operational link between laboratories in France, China, and Saudi Arabia. Organise skill transfer programmes, technical documentation, and training. Coordinate travel and support of experts from other sites. Harmonise methods and tools across laboratories to ensure consistency. Project Management: Lead the overall project timeline, milestones, budget, and risk management. Provide regular reporting to Group management. Anticipate resource, equipment, and budgetary needs. Ensure safety, quality, and on‑time delivery throughout the transfer process. Local and Institutional Interface: Coordinate interactions with local authorities, customs, and certification bodies. Secure importation of sensitive equipment (measurement instruments, RF devices). Represent society with local technical partners and institutional stakeholders. Continuous Improvement and Innovation: Propose improvements to enhance laboratory efficiency and performance. Establish KPIs for laboratory activity and quality monitoring. Promote best practices in safety, metrology, and traceability. 🎯 Profile Education: Engineering degree in Electronics, Telecommunications, Physical Measurements, or Industrial Engineering. Experience: 5 to 10 years of technical project management, ideally involving laboratory set‑up or transfer. Experience in telecom, electronic, or medical testing laboratories (with measurement, calibration, or ISO/IEC compliance) is highly relevant. International experience preferred (Europe / Asia / Middle East). Technical Skills: Knowledge of measurement systems (EMC, RF, climatic, mechanical, or electrical testing). Understanding of qualification and calibration processes. Strong project management expertise (planning, budgeting, risk control). Familiarity with ISO certifications, or equivalent standards. General understanding of technical infrastructure (HVAC, electrical safety, calibration, data systems). Soft Skills: Strong project leadership and multicultural coordination abilities. Organisational rigor and methodical approach. Ability to manage priorities and operate under tight deadlines. Excellent interpersonal and intercultural communication skills. Result‑ and quality‑oriented mindset.
